Laszlo J.., Schuller D. and Gaal M. Cholesterol mobilization in the brain
(Russian ter7t Acts, morphol. Acad. scient. hung. (Budapeat).1952, 311 (33-41) nlum. 8
Soriet investigatorshave demonstrated that the brain is involved in the cholesterol
metabolism-The present authors found a marked difference in cholesterol level
between the femoral vein and the superior sagittal sinus. Investigations on the
CBS (Schulz reaction; polarization method) in the case of destructive processes
revealed an increased cholesterol level associated with the presence of fatty gran-
ule cells in the cerebral capillaries and the dural.sinus; the endothelial cells and
the many corpora mylacea present also contained cholesterol. Brandt- Berlin (V;8)
